digital-certificate相关内容
我是加密证书新手,正在尝试为Android应用程序找出./META-INF文件夹下的“CERT.RSA”文件的组件。 据我了解,“CERT.RSA”用于验证同一目录下的“CERT.SF”文件的签名。包括证书元信息(主体、颁发者、序列号等),开发者私钥签名的CERT.SF签名,以及用于验证签名的公钥。 如何从“CERT.RSA”文件派生上述组件?特别是,如何从CERT.RSA中检索公钥?
..
..
我可以通过 java 在我的系统上安装证书吗 类似这样的东西.证书[] 证书 = someClass.getsystemCertificates(); 有没有可用的api???? 解决方案 您可以使用 keytool 命令获取您的 cacerts 文件中的证书列表,该文件是 Java 批准的证书的集合附带.此密钥库的默认密码是“changeit". keytool -li
..
..
我需要 Delphi 中的一个函数来验证外部 EXE 或 DLL 的数字签名.在我的特定应用程序中,我偶尔会调用其他进程,但出于安全考虑,我想确保这些可执行文件是由我们的组织在运行之前创建的. 我看过 微软在 C 中的示例,但是,我不想要如果其他人已经有的话,浪费时间将其翻译成 Delphi. 与第三方库相比,我更喜欢片段或代码示例.谢谢. 解决方案 给你: //IsCode
..
我有一个使用 Visual Studio 2012 中的 Install Shield 受限版本创建的安装程序. 我有一个想要添加到安装程序的数字证书. 我想使用 Install Shield 的 SingleImage 功能来创建单个安装文件(例如 setup.exe)并将其交付给我的客户.然而,似乎我必须将数字证书附加到一个 msi 文件中,该文件由 Install Shield
..
..
我正在尝试使用 x.509 证书对 XML 文件进行签名,我可以使用私钥对文档进行签名,然后使用 CheckSignature 方法(它具有接收证书作为参数的重载)来验证签名. 问题是验证签名的用户必须拥有证书,我担心的是,如果用户拥有证书,那么他可以访问私钥,据我所知,这是私有的,应该只可用给签名的用户. 我错过了什么? 感谢您的帮助. 解决方案 在 .NET 中,如果
..
..
..
我拥有由 CA1 证书签名的客户端证书“A".CA1 证书由根证书签名. 现在我有了 CA1 证书(受信任)并收到了客户端证书(不受信任).在验证期间,我只需要使用 CA1(受信任)验证客户端证书的信任路径.我没有/receive 根证书. 是否可以进行此验证? 我正在使用 Openssl 1.0.0g 版本库.如果有人知道如何做到这一点,请与我分享. 解决方案 既然你已
..
有没有什么方法可以以编程方式确定 .xls 是否包含宏,而无需在 Excel 中实际打开它? 还有什么方法可以检查这些宏是用哪个证书(包括时间戳证书)签名的?再次不使用 Excel. 我特别想知道,当存在宏时,是否有任何字符串总是出现在 Excel 文件的原始数据中. 解决方案 可以,您可以将.xls文件作为复合文档文件打开,并检查是否包含VBA文件夹和包含VBA代码的流.
..
如何在PHP中创建数字证书并导出为.p12文件? 我希望 .p12 文件包含私钥.并且还要检查密钥对是否已经发出(登录数据库). 我发现了一个名为“openssl_pkcs12_export_to_file"的函数,但不知道从哪里开始.看来我需要一个 X509 证书和一个私钥. 解决方案 "sha1","x509_extensions" =>"v3_ca",“req_exten
..
我有西班牙当局 (FNMT) 颁发的有效证书,我想使用它以了解更多信息.该文件的扩展名为 .p12 我想阅读其中的信息(名字和姓氏)并检查证书是否有效.可以用 pyOpenSSL 做到这一点吗?我想我必须在 OpenSSL 中使用加密模块.任何帮助或有用的链接?尝试在这里阅读:http://packages.python.org/pyOpenSSL/openssl-crypto.html 但
..
我正在尝试使用服务器的 .cer 证书文件建立 https 连接.我可以使用浏览器手动获取证书文件,并使用 keytool 将其放入密钥库.然后我可以使用 java 代码访问密钥库,获取我添加到密钥库的证书并连接到服务器. 然而,我现在甚至想要使用 java 代码实现获取证书文件并将其添加到我的密钥库的过程,而不使用 keytool 或浏览器来获取证书. 有人可以告诉我如何处理这个问题
..
我正在尝试让 Access 2000 数据库在 Access 2010 运行时中运行,并删除有关文件不受信任的警告对话框.我做了一些研究并发现了 SelfCert.exe 程序.这是一个很好的证书教程. 还有这个. 甚至 Microsoft 也有针对 Access 2000 的说明,指出应该存在此菜单项.但是,Access 2000 VBA IDE 中的“工具"菜单没有“数字签名"菜单项.更糟糕的
..
我知道可以使用此链接,以为OpenSSL中的自签名证书生成一个公共密钥和一个私有密钥.但是对于给定的公钥,我可以找出对应的私钥吗?我一直在使用1024位RSA公钥. 因为我的作业中有这个问题: 为句子“我的名字是"生成数字签名.我的声音就是我的护照."可以使用带有以下1024位RSA公钥的OpenSSL进行正确验证.(提示:可能未像正常的RSA模数那样生成模数.): -----
..
我正在使用Java中的X509证书.给出证书,是否有可能在签名层次结构中找到所有其他证书,直到您获得根证书? 我有一个证书文件(带有 .cer 扩展名),我想提取父签名证书.我要一直寻找该证书的父级,直到获得最终的根证书,该证书是自签名的. 我已经在 java.security.cert 中检查了X509Certificate证书API和相关API,但是找不到有用的东西. 解决方
..
在某些站点上,证书链无法建立到受信任的根证书,因为Windows未知此受信任的根证书.但是,如果我们使用IE或Chrome浏览器访问此类网站,则Windows会自动在某个位置下载(验证)受信任的根目录,并将其以静默方式安装到受信任的证书颁发机构存储中.之后,我们可以将证书链构建到新安装的根目录.如果我们从Windows存储中手动删除新下载的受信任的根证书,则无法再次构建该链. 我知道授权信息
..
以下对 openssl 的请求挂起 openssl req -key server.key -out server.csr 知道可能是什么问题吗? 解决方案 您需要另一个参数,它希望从标准输入中读取证书.可能是您打算添加 -new 作为命令行参数,或者您需要通过标准输入中的现有证书.
..